Description
【発明の詳細な説明】
産業上の利用分野
本発明は、灯油などの液体燃料、水・薬液など
の液体の霧化ポンプに関するものであり、さらに
詳しくは、圧電振動子などの電気振動子を利用し
た霧化ポンプに関するものである。D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ION Field of Industrial Application The present invention relates to an atomizing pump for liquid fuels such as kerosene and liquids such as water and chemical solutions. This relates to the atomization pump used.
従来例の構成とその問題点
従来のこの種の霧化ポンプは、第1図に示すよ
うに構成されている。すなわち電気振動子1の相
対向する平滑面には、電極膜2a,2bが形成さ
れ、電極膜2bとノズル板3とは有機系あるいは
無機系の接着剤、または軟鑞などの固着層4aを
介して接合がされていた。また、ノズル板3の他
方(裏面)の面とボデイー5は、上述の接着剤あ
るいは軟鑞などをと同じ固着層4bを介して接合
がされていた。Structure of a conventional example and its problems A conventional atomizing pump of this type has a structure as shown in FIG. That is, electrode films 2a and 2b are formed on opposing smooth surfaces of the electric vibrator 1, and the electrode film 2b and the nozzle plate 3 are bonded with a fixing layer 4a such as organic or inorganic adhesive or soft solder. The connection was made through the Further, the other (back) surface of the nozzle plate 3 and the body 5 were bonded to each other via the same adhesive layer 4b as the above-mentioned adhesive or soft solder.
電気振動子1は主成分がPbO、TiO2、ZrO2な
どからなるセラミツク体で、円形中央部に開口部
を設けたリング形状を有し、電極膜2a,2bは
銀系などの厚膜用導電性ペーストの焼結体、ある
いは金属蒸着膜、金属鍍金膜などが用いられてい
た。ノズル板3は、厚さ約50μm程度でデイスク
状に加工された金属板が用いられ、その中央部に
は、ノズル孔6の貫通孔(孔径約70〜100μm)
が、複数個設けられていた。ボデイー5は金属の
円柱体で上部には、ノズル板3を接合するための
支持部7、その外周部には組立時にノズル板3を
位置決め等するためループ状の側壁8、また支持
部7の中央には凹状の液体室9が設けられ液体室
9からは左右方向に液体通路10が一対設けられ
ていた。電極膜2aは、外部リード線接続用電極
である。 The electric vibrator 1 is a ceramic body whose main components are PbO, TiO 2 , ZrO 2 , etc., and has a ring shape with an opening in the center of the circle, and the electrode films 2 a and 2 b are made of thick films such as silver. A sintered body of conductive paste, a metal vapor deposition film, a metal plating film, etc. were used. The nozzle plate 3 is a metal plate processed into a disk shape with a thickness of approximately 50 μm, and a through hole for the nozzle hole 6 (hole diameter approximately 70 to 100 μm) is provided in the center of the nozzle plate 3.
However, there were several. The body 5 is a cylindrical metal body with a support part 7 on the upper part for joining the nozzle plate 3, a loop-shaped side wall 8 on the outer periphery for positioning the nozzle plate 3 during assembly, and a support part 7 for the support part 7. A concave liquid chamber 9 was provided in the center, and a pair of liquid passages 10 were provided from the liquid chamber 9 in the left and right direction. The electrode film 2a is an electrode for connecting an external lead wire.
従来の霧化ポンプは、以上の様にして構成がな
されていた。 Conventional atomizing pumps have been configured as described above.
この構成では、電気振動子1が表に露出されて
いるため、電極膜2a,2b間、電極膜2aと固
着層4a間、電極膜2aとノズル板3間など、こ
の表面に結露または異物の付着が生じ、リーク電
流が誘起され、そのため電気的に発振停止や発振
周波数を変動させ動作を不安定にする欠点があつ
た。 In this configuration, since the electric vibrator 1 is exposed to the surface, there may be condensation or foreign matter on the surface between the electrode films 2a and 2b, between the electrode film 2a and the fixed layer 4a, between the electrode film 2a and the nozzle plate 3, etc. Adhesion occurs and leakage current is induced, which has the disadvantage of electrically stopping oscillation or changing the oscillation frequency, making the operation unstable.
発明の目的
本発明は、かかる従来の欠点を解消するもので
発振停止、発振周波数の不安定性などを除去した
実用性の高い霧化ポンプを提供することを目的と
する。OBJECTS OF THE INVENTION It is an object of the present invention to provide a highly practical atomizing pump that eliminates such conventional drawbacks, such as oscillation stoppage and oscillation frequency instability.
発明の構成
この目的を達成するために本発明は、電気振動
子とノズル板とボデイーを、それぞれ接合後、電
気振動子(引出用リード線他端部を含む)と、ノ
ズル板の一表面を、電気絶縁性と弾性ならびに撥
水性を有する被覆剤で埋込した保護構造からな
る。Structure of the Invention In order to achieve this object, the present invention connects the electric vibrator (including the other end of the lead wire) and one surface of the nozzle plate after joining the electric vibrator, the nozzle plate, and the body, respectively. It consists of a protective structure embedded with a coating material that has electrical insulation, elasticity, and water repellency.
実施例の説明
以下、本発明の一実施例を第2図を用いて説明
する。尚、第1図と同一部材については、同一番
号を付している。DESCRIPTION OF EMBODIMENTS An embodiment of the present invention will be described below with reference to FIG. Note that the same members as in FIG. 1 are given the same numbers.
第2図において、電気振動子1はリング形状
(寸法:外径約φ10mm、内径約φ4mm、厚さ約1mm)
の圧要素子で、その平滑な両面上には、電極膜2
a,2bが形成された従来と同様のものである。
ノズル板3は、デイスク状の金属薄板で、その中
央部には微細(約100μm程度)な貫通穴がノズ
ル孔6として設けられている。電気振動子1の電
極膜2bと、ノズル板3の一方の表面は、従来と
同様の方法で固着層4aを介し、接合がなされて
いる。この様にして接合された振動子ユニツトの
ノズル板3の他方の面は、金属からなるボデイー
5に従来と同様の方法で固着層4bを介し、接合
される。ボデイー5には、ノズル板3との接合の
ための支持部7、振動子ユニツト組立時の位置決
めならびに該ユニツト部を保護するために側壁
8、液体を充填する液体室9、液体供給のための
液体通路10などが設けられている。 In Figure 2, the electric vibrator 1 has a ring shape (dimensions: outer diameter approximately φ10 mm, inner diameter approximately φ4 mm, thickness approximately 1 mm).
The pressure element has an electrode film 2 on its smooth surfaces.
This is the same as the conventional one in which a and 2b are formed.
The nozzle plate 3 is a disk-shaped thin metal plate, and a minute (approximately 100 μm) through hole is provided as a nozzle hole 6 in the center thereof. The electrode film 2b of the electric vibrator 1 and one surface of the nozzle plate 3 are bonded to each other via the fixing layer 4a in a conventional manner. The other surface of the nozzle plate 3 of the vibrator unit thus bonded is bonded to the metal body 5 via the fixing layer 4b in the same manner as in the prior art. The body 5 includes a support part 7 for joining with the nozzle plate 3, a side wall 8 for positioning and protecting the unit when assembling the vibrator unit, a liquid chamber 9 to be filled with liquid, and a liquid chamber 9 for supplying liquid. A liquid passage 10 and the like are provided.
この様にして組立られた霧化ポンプユニツト
は、発振回路(図省略)からの電圧を印加するた
めの接続用にリード線11aが、電気振動子1の
電極膜2a面に接続される。次に、リード線11
aの端部を含め、電気振動子1およびノズル板3
が全体に埋込されるよう、弾性と撥水性を有す被
覆剤12を充填した。被覆剤12はシリコーンゴ
ムを選び、充填時、ノズル孔6近傍にはマスク材
を覆い、このゴムが硬化後、除去しノズル孔6付
近は開口部になる様にした。 In the atomizing pump unit assembled in this way, a lead wire 11a is connected to the electrode film 2a surface of the electric vibrator 1 for connection for applying a voltage from an oscillation circuit (not shown). Next, lead wire 11
Electric vibrator 1 and nozzle plate 3, including the end of a
A coating material 12 having elasticity and water repellency was filled so that it was embedded throughout. Silicone rubber was selected as the coating material 12, and at the time of filling, the vicinity of the nozzle hole 6 was covered with a masking material, and after the rubber had hardened, it was removed, leaving the vicinity of the nozzle hole 6 as an opening.
上記構成において、発振回路から電圧印加によ
り、電気振動子1は発振され、固着層4bを介し
てノズル板3を加振する。ノズル板3の加振によ
り、液体室9に充填された液体は加圧され、ノズ
ル孔6を介し噴霧化される。この動作時に、電気
振動子1の表面に結露あるいは異物が付着した場
合、リーク電流が生じ、発振停止や発振周波数を
変動させ、噴霧化を不安定にする原因になつてい
た。しかし、本発明の構成では、電気振動子1な
らびにノズル板3の一表面が全体に被覆剤12で
覆う様、充填されているため、電極膜2a,2b
間あるいは電極膜2aとノズル板3間は絶縁保護
される。従つて、上記の様な事態が生じても、リ
ーク電流の発生は防止できる。そのため、発振停
止や発振周波数の変動のない、安定動作を実現で
きる。また、充填された被覆剤12は、負荷質量
としてQ値に作用するが、本構成によれば3〜6
%の効率低下であり、実用的に問題のないレベル
であつた。 In the above configuration, the electric vibrator 1 is oscillated by applying a voltage from the oscillation circuit, and vibrates the nozzle plate 3 via the fixed layer 4b. By the vibration of the nozzle plate 3, the liquid filled in the liquid chamber 9 is pressurized and atomized through the nozzle hole 6. During this operation, if dew condensation or foreign matter adheres to the surface of the electric vibrator 1, a leakage current is generated, causing the oscillation to stop or the oscillation frequency to fluctuate, making atomization unstable. However, in the configuration of the present invention, since one surface of the electric vibrator 1 and the nozzle plate 3 is filled with the coating material 12, the electrode films 2a, 2b
Insulating protection is provided between the electrode film 2a and the nozzle plate 3. Therefore, even if the above situation occurs, leakage current can be prevented from occurring. Therefore, stable operation can be achieved without stopping oscillation or changing the oscillation frequency. In addition, the filled coating material 12 acts on the Q value as a load mass, but according to this configuration, the Q value is 3 to 6.
%, which was at a level that caused no practical problems.
また、本発明の構成によれば以上の他に次の利
点がある。電気振動子1が被覆剤12で埋込され
るため、露出部が無くなり機械的損傷を受け難い
構造にすることが出来る。被覆剤12で埋込をし
ているため、薄膜に比べピンホールによる絶縁不
良問題も極めて少ない。リード線11a接続部に
おいても、被覆剤12を充填しているため、超音
波衝撃を緩和し、超音波衝撃による接続部損傷の
防止効果がある。 Furthermore, the configuration of the present invention has the following advantages in addition to the above. Since the electric vibrator 1 is embedded with the coating material 12, there is no exposed part, and the structure can be made less susceptible to mechanical damage. Since the coating is filled with the coating material 12, the problem of poor insulation due to pinholes is extremely less compared to thin films. Since the connecting portion of the lead wire 11a is also filled with the coating material 12, it is effective in alleviating the ultrasonic impact and preventing damage to the connecting portion due to the ultrasonic impact.
発明の効果
以上のように本発明の霧化ポンプによれば、次
の効果が得られる。Effects of the Invention As described above, according to the atomizing pump of the present invention, the following effects can be obtained.
(1) 電気振動子およびノズル板の一表面を、被覆
剤により埋込した保護構造にすることにより、
結露や異物の付着などによるリーク電流の発生
を防止することができる。従つて、動作時の発
振停止や発振周波数の変動による動作不安定さ
を阻止する効果が得られる。(1) By creating a protective structure in which one surface of the electric vibrator and nozzle plate is embedded with a coating material,
It is possible to prevent leakage current from occurring due to dew condensation or adhesion of foreign matter. Therefore, the effect of preventing oscillation stoppage during operation and instability of operation due to fluctuations in oscillation frequency can be obtained.
